Getting There

  • Metro

    Take Metro Line 5 from central stations like Gran Vía or Chueca to reach Hortaleza area in 5-10 minutes, €1.50-2 fare, frequent service.

  • Walking

    From Puerta del Sol or Plaza Mayor, walk 10-15 minutes through pedestrian-friendly Centro streets, free and scenic.

  • Bus

    Board bus lines 3 or 5 from Sol or Callao stops, 5-8 minute ride to nearby drop-off, €1.50 single ticket.

Iconic Presence in Madrid's Literary Scene

Librería Pérez Galdós occupies a prime spot on Calle de Hortaleza in the heart of Madrid's Centro district, a street famed for its blend of historic charm and lively commerce. Named after Benito Pérez Galdós, Spain's towering 19th-century novelist whose works chronicled the nation's social upheavals, the bookstore embodies Madrid's deep-rooted passion for literature. Established decades ago, it has evolved into a cultural anchor, drawing bibliophiles from across the city and beyond who appreciate its commitment to quality over quantity in a digital age.

A Curated World of Books

Inside, expect an meticulously curated selection that caters to diverse tastes. Spanish literature dominates with complete works by Galdós, Cervantes, and contemporary authors like Javier Marías, alongside translations of global heavyweights from Gabriel García Márquez to Elena Ferrante. Sections for poetry, essays, children's books, and academic texts ensure something for every reader. Rare and antiquarian volumes add a collector's allure, often featuring first editions or beautifully bound classics that whisper of Madrid's golden literary eras. The inventory reflects a thoughtful curation, prioritizing enduring value and cultural significance.
